What exactly is an Overhand Serve?
An overhand provide is a technique the place the server tosses the ball above shoulder top and strikes it having an open up hand to mail it around the net. Not like an underhand serve, which relies more on Manage and accuracy, an overhand provide can deliver ability, pace, as well as unpredictable movement. This makes it more difficult for that opposing workforce to acquire, supplying your crew an advantage.

There's two key different types of overhand serves: the topspin serve as well as the float serve. The topspin provide generates forward spin, creating the ball to dip swiftly. The float provide, However, moves unpredictably through the air because of minimal spin, rendering it challenging for receivers to predict wherever it can land.

Phase-by-Step: Ways to Conduct an Overhand Provide
1. Enter into Place
Get started by standing guiding the top line in the court docket, facing forward with the toes shoulder-width aside. In case you are right-handed, spot your still left foot a little bit in front of your proper. Reverse this when you are remaining-handed.

two. Maintain and Toss the Ball
Maintain the ball in your non-dominant hand out before you at about shoulder peak. Toss it straight up—about 12 to eighteen inches over your head—and just slightly forward. The toss ought to be consistent and controlled, as it's vital to making An effective provide.

3. Swing Your Serving Arm
When you toss the ball, carry your dominant hand back guiding your head using your elbow bent, comparable to how you would probably throw a ball. Swing your arm ahead in a single easy movement.

4. Make Call
Strike the ball by having an open up palm at the very best issue of the toss. For a topspin serve, mmlive snap your wrist while you make contact. For the float provide, strike the ball firmly by using a rigid wrist to reduce spin.

5. Comply with Through
Soon after earning Make contact with, comply with as a result of together with your arm while in the course within your target. The body must In a natural way transfer forward as Element of the motion. Make certain to not cross the serving line until finally after the ball is strike.
